What Is Dehydration?

Dehydration occurs when the body loses more fluids than it takes in.

Water is essential for:

Maintaining body temperature

Supporting digestion

Carrying nutrients

Removing waste products

Proper brain and muscle function

When fluid levels drop too low, the body cannot function efficiently.

During hot weather, the body loses water rapidly through sweating.

Common reasons include:

✔ Excessive sweating

✔ Not drinking enough water

✔ Diarrhea and vomiting

✔ Outdoor work under the sun

✔ Intense physical activity

✔ High fever

Symptoms of Dehydration

The symptoms depend on severity.

Mild Dehydration

Thirst

Dry mouth

Fatigue

Mild headache

Moderate Dehydration

Dizziness

Weakness

Reduced urination

Dark yellow urine

Severe Dehydration

Rapid heartbeat

Confusion

Sunken eyes

Very low urine output

Fainting

⚠ Severe dehydration requires urgent medical attention.

Who Is Most at Risk?

Children

Children lose fluids faster and may not recognize thirst.

Elderly Individuals

Older adults often have reduced thirst sensation.

Outdoor Workers

Farmers, laborers, drivers, and construction workers are at increased risk.

Athletes

Heavy sweating increases fluid loss.

Warning Signs You Should Never Ignore

Seek immediate medical care if you notice:

Fainting

Confusion

Inability to drink fluids

Persistent vomiting

Very little urination

These may indicate severe dehydration.

Best Drinks for Hydration

To maintain fluid balance:

✔ Water

✔ ORS (Oral Rehydration Solution)

✔ Coconut Water

✔ Lemon Water

✔ Fresh Fruit Juices (without excessive sugar)

Foods That Help Prevent Dehydration

Water-Rich Fruits

Watermelon

Melons

Oranges

Grapes

Vegetables

Cucumber

Lettuce

Tomatoes

These foods help replenish lost fluids naturally.

How to Prevent Dehydration

Drink Water Regularly

Do not wait until you feel thirsty.

Avoid Peak Heat Hours

Try to stay indoors between 11 AM and 4 PM.

Wear Lightweight Clothing

Choose breathable fabrics.

Replace Lost Electrolytes

Use ORS when necessary.

Increase Fluid Intake During Illness

Vomiting, diarrhea, and fever increase fluid requirements.

Common Myths About Dehydration

Myth 1: Only Athletes Get Dehydrated

False. Anyone can become dehydrated.

Myth 2: Thirst Is the First Sign

Not always. Many people become dehydrated before feeling thirsty.

Myth 3: Soft Drinks Are Good for Hydration

Many sugary drinks can actually worsen dehydration.

When Should You See a Doctor?

Consult a healthcare professional if:

Symptoms persist

Severe weakness develops

Repeated vomiting occurs

Confusion appears

Urination becomes very infrequent

Early treatment helps prevent complications.
